Beauty Names from Different Cultures

Every language has its own way of expressing beauty through names, and the differences are fascinating.

Arabic is one of the richest languages for beauty names. Jamal and Jamil both mean "handsome" or "beautiful" for boys, while Jamila is the feminine form. Hassan and Husain mean "handsome and good." Shakil means "well-formed and handsome," and Zaina means "beautiful and graceful." In Arabic naming tradition, physical beauty and moral goodness are often expressed by the same word.

Irish and Gaelic traditions are full of beauty names for both genders. Fionn and Finnian mean "fair and handsome." Kevin means "handsome and gentle." Caoimhe (pronounced KEE-va) means "gentle and beautiful." Niamh (pronounced NEEV) means "bright and radiant." Aoife means "beautiful and radiant." The Irish concept of beauty often intertwines with fairness and brightness.

Japanese beauty names use kanji characters that layer meaning. Keiko means "blessed, beautiful child." Mei (also a Chinese name meaning beautiful) is simple and elegant. Yumiko means "beautiful, kind child." Sumi means "refined and beautiful." Haruki means "spring radiance" — beauty tied to the natural world. French gave English some of its most recognizable beauty names. Beau means "handsome." Belle and Bella mean "beautiful." Jolie means "pretty." Bellamy means "beautiful friend." Greek beauty names often carry mythological weight. Calista and Callista mean "most beautiful." Adonis was the mortal so beautiful that Aphrodite herself fell in love. Calliope means "beautiful voice" and was the muse of epic poetry. Helen (Helene) — the face that launched a thousand ships — means "bright and beautiful."

African beauty names are direct and powerful. Zuri (Swahili) means "beautiful." Hasani (Swahili) means "handsome." Obi (Igbo) carries connotations of the heart and beauty. These names often connect physical beauty to goodness of character.

Choosing a Name That Means Beautiful

Beauty names come in a wide range of styles, and the right one depends on what kind of beauty speaks to you.

Simple and direct names like Bella, Beau, Zuri, and Mei wear their meaning plainly. Everyone who hears them senses the beauty in the name, even without knowing the etymology. These names are easy to spell, easy to pronounce, and immediately warm.

Mythological and literary beauty names carry stories. Adonis, Calliope, Helen, and Nefertiti bring centuries of cultural weight. These names can feel grand and significant — perfect for parents who want a name with depth and narrative.

Cultural beauty names like Keiko, Jamal, Caoimhe, and Fionn root your child in a specific tradition. If you have a connection to a particular culture, choosing a beauty name from that tradition honors your heritage while giving your child a meaningful name.

Consider pronunciation. Some of the most beautiful beauty names — Caoimhe, Niamh, Aoife — have pronunciations that may not be intuitive to everyone. This is not a reason to avoid them, but it is worth considering how often you will need to correct people and whether that matters to you. Think about the full name. A beauty name as a first name pairs well with a stronger, more grounded middle name (or vice versa). Bella Grace, Jamal Alexander, Keiko Rose — the contrast between beauty and substance often creates a name that feels complete.
